About Ö Hägermark

Ö Hägermark is a scholar working on Dermatology, Immunology and Allergy, Rheumatology, Physiology and Immunology, having authored 57 papers that have together received 2.4k indexed citations. Recurring topics across this work include Dermatology and Skin Diseases (28 papers), Urticaria and Related Conditions (19 papers), Allergic Rhinitis and Sensitization (17 papers), Contact Dermatitis and Allergies (11 papers), Asthma and respiratory diseases (8 papers), Food Allergy and Anaphylaxis Research (8 papers), Mast cells and histamine (4 papers) and Drug-Induced Adverse Reactions (3 papers). The work is most often cited by research in Dermatology (1.3k citations), Immunology and Allergy (679 citations), Rheumatology (659 citations), Sensory Systems (175 citations) and Physiology (741 citations). Ö Hägermark has collaborated with scholars based in Sweden, Taiwan and Israel. Frequent co-authors include B. Fjellner, Tomas Hökfelt, Bengt Pernow, Mona Ståhle‐Bäckdahl, C F Wahlgren, Kjell Strandberg, Sharon Stone‐Elander, Martin Ingvar, Jen‐Chuen Hsieh and Annika Scheynius. Their work appears in journals such as Acta Dermato Venereologica, Skin Pharmacology and Physiology, Allergy, Journal of Investigative Dermatology and Advances in experimental medicine and biology.
